What the research actually shows
Both studies had school-level allocation features, but allocation concealment, examiner blinding, cluster-adjusted analysis, and prospective registration concordance were not fully established. Curnow retained 428 of 534 children, with D1 increments of 0.81 versus 1.19 and D3 increments of 0.21 versus 0.48. Nicholson, Chesters, and Huntington were affiliated with Unilever Dental Research in the paper. Jackson's completer analysis included 181 versus 189. Funding was not verified and was not inferred.
Why this is classified as C (50)
The studies measured actual new caries and pointed in the same direction. Yet funding for a second independent program was not verified, and arm denominators, cluster-adjusted confidence intervals, and full tables needed for standardized magnitude could not be recovered from the public record. Attrition and completer analysis add limitations. One hard-outcome strength gives C with 50 points.
Counterpoint. This C grade does not deny the much broader evidence that fluoride toothpaste itself prevents caries; it addresses the incremental effect of a school-supervised program.

Evidence Table
| Study | Design | Sample | Funding | Endpoint | Result | Weight |
|---|---|---|---|---|---|---|
| Study 1 | Randomized school-supervised brushing trial in high-caries-risk children | 428 | Primary-paper funding and acknowledgments not verified; Nicholson, Chesters, and Huntington were affiliated with Unilever Dental Research | Permanent-molar and overall caries increment | D1 caries increment 0.81 versus 1.19; D3 0.21 versus 0.48; between-group CIs not verified | Directionally supportive trial with substantial attrition and precision limitations |
| Study 2 | School-cluster allocated supervised-brushing clinical trial | 189 | Primary-paper funding not verified | Overall dmfs plus DMFS and proximal-surface caries increment over about 21 months | Overall 2.60 versus 2.92 surfaces, 10.9% lower, P<.001; proximal surfaces 0.78 versus 1.03, P<.01; CI not reported | Pivotal positive trial limited by completer analysis and unverified cluster adjustment |
